Lyme Disease

Lyme disease is one of the most common tick-transmitted diseases. Its tell-tale symptom is a bulls-eye shaped rash around the tick bite. Diagnosing Lyme disease in dogs is difficult because the bite area is covered by fur. A symptom of Lyme disease in dogs is lameness, but this is often mistaken for regular arthritis. At a veterinary hospital in Virginia, 120 lame dogs were tested for arthritis and Lyme disease. The results showed that 42 of the dogs had Lyme disease, and 96 had arthritis.
